cheers mate,

I plan to have another go if i can find the time.

The wheel would`ve worked ok if i`d made the inner fuel sections longer than the outer sections or split the clockwise/anticlockwise directions between the inner and outer drivers.

As it was, i used all the outers for clockwise and all the inners for anticlockwise. The result was the inners just didn`t have the duration or leverage (being much closer to the hub) to overcome the inertia and they only managed to stop the wheel in time for the next clockwise driver to kick in :lol:

Looking on the brightside i learned something from it and it may help others avoid the issue.

I don`t think the fusing will be as fiddly this time with the independant drivers. I`ll put 4 on the front and 4 on the back to provide a bit more seperation otherwise i can see a driver doing a blowlamp impression on the one directly behind it ;) I`ll drill 3 more holes in the frame to route the matchpipe through to the other side but the other 4 pipes can be routed around the outside.

 

A bad back and a cold environment don`t mix, it`d be worth fitting some insulation after you get the door sorted. The 8 drivers will be attached to the frame like the spokes of a wheel (4 front and 4 back) but as you say it can also be used with standard wheel driver configuration. I`d use the big holes to route cable ties and file some notches in the edge of the frame to stop them sliding around. My hexagonal wheel frame can carry 2, 3 or 6 drivers and this new octagonal will do 2, 4 or 8.. lots of options from 2 frames. :)

 

I tested the burn duration of the colour comps earlier, i`ll test a driver tomorrow and could have it done by the weekend.
